Ya it's looking like a No win... only way I could see it swinging is if something dramatic happens in Edinburgh. Of the remaining big population counties only Highlands and Glasgow were considered likely Yes counties. North and South Lanarkshire and Aberdeenshire were all predicted to be small wash margins and Edinburgh and Fife no wins.
